  • Perkin Warbeck - Wikipedia
    Perkin Warbeck (c 1474 – 23 November 1499) was a pretender to the English throne claiming to be Richard of Shrewsbury, Duke of York, who was the second son of Edward IV and one of the so-called "Princes in the Tower"

  • The Execution of Perkin Warbeck - History Today
    On November 23rd, 1499, Perkin Warbeck was drawn on a hurdle from the Tower to Tyburn to be hanged A native of Tournai, his six-year masquerade as Richard, Duke of York had come to an end two years previously

  • Perkin Warbeck - Spartacus Educational
    In July 1495 Warbeck appeared off Deal and landed a number of men, while prudently remaining on board himself The invaders were quickly rounded up by the sheriff of Kent, so Warbeck sailed off first to Ireland and then to Scotland to try his luck

  • November 23 – The execution of Pretender Perkin Warbeck
    On this day in Tudor history, 23rd November 1499, in the reign of King Henry VII, Perkin Warbeck was hanged at Tyburn Warbeck was executed for allegedly plotting to help another claimant, Edward, Earl of Warwick, escape from the Tower of London
